Crown molding installation services involve attaching decorative trim along the upper edges of walls where they meet the ceiling. This process typically includes measuring, cutting, and securing the molding to achieve a seamless and polished look. Skilled professionals often customize the molding to match the interior design style, whether traditional, modern, or transitional, ensuring an aesthetic enhancement that elevates the overall appearance of a space. Proper installation requires attention to detail to ensure the molding fits precisely and is securely anchored, resulting in a clean and refined finish.
One of the primary benefits of crown molding installation is its ability to address common interior design challenges. It can conceal imperfections or gaps where walls and ceilings meet, creating a more uniform and finished appearance. Additionally, crown molding can add visual interest and a sense of height to a room, making spaces feel more elegant and spacious. For properties with existing damage or uneven surfaces, professional installation can also help hide flaws and improve the overall aesthetic, providing a polished look without the need for extensive repairs.

Material and Design Costs - The cost of crown molding installation typically ranges from $6 to $20 per linear foot, depending on material choices like wood or polyurethane. For a standard 10-foot room, this could amount to $60 to $200 for materials and installation. More intricate designs or premium materials may increase costs.
Labor Expenses - Labor charges for crown molding installation generally fall between $4 and $10 per linear foot. For an average room, labor costs can range from $40 to $100, depending on complexity and local rates. Additional prep work or custom fitting may add to the overall expense.
Room Size and Complexity - Larger or more complex spaces tend to incur higher costs, with installation fees rising proportionally. For example, a 15-foot wall might cost between $90 and $150 for installation alone, excluding materials. Detailed molding profiles can further influence pricing.
Additional Costs - Extra services such as painting, filling gaps, or finishing can add $2 to $5 per linear foot. These finishing touches ensure a polished look and may increase total project costs accordingly.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
